Section 1: The Fundamental Conversion Factor: Bridging the Pound and Kilo Divide
The core of any weight conversion lies in understanding the relationship between pounds (lbs) and kilograms (kg). One kilogram is approximately equal to 2.20462 pounds. This seemingly insignificant decimal holds the key to unlocking all our weight conversion needs. Think of it as the Rosetta Stone of the weight world, translating between two different systems. This constant allows us to move seamlessly between the imperial (pounds) and metric (kilograms) systems. It's a fundamental principle that underpins everything we'll discuss regarding 102 pounds.
Section 2: Calculating 102 Pounds in Kilograms: A Step-by-Step Approach
Now, let's tackle the main event: converting 102 pounds into kilograms. The simplest method involves direct substitution using our conversion factor. We know 1 kg ≈ 2.20462 lbs, so we can set up a simple equation:
102 lbs (1 kg / 2.20462 lbs) ≈ 46.26 kg
Therefore, 102 pounds is approximately equal to 46.26 kilograms. Notice the use of "approximately." This is because our conversion factor is a rounded figure. For most everyday purposes, 46.26 kg is sufficiently accurate. However, for highly precise scientific or engineering applications, more decimal places might be necessary.
Section 3: Real-World Applications: Why Does This Conversion Matter?
Understanding this conversion is crucial in numerous real-world scenarios. For example:
International Shipping: When shipping goods internationally, weight specifications are often given in kilograms. Knowing the kilogram equivalent of 102 pounds is essential for accurate shipping calculations and avoiding extra charges.
Healthcare: Doctors and nurses frequently use kilograms when determining dosages of medication or assessing a patient's BMI (Body Mass Index), making the conversion essential for accurate patient care.
Fitness Goals: Many fitness trackers and apps use the metric system. Understanding that 102 pounds is about 46.26 kilograms is crucial for setting and monitoring fitness goals.
Travel: Luggage weight restrictions on airlines are usually stated in kilograms. Knowing the conversion ensures you don't incur excess baggage fees.
Section 4: Beyond the Calculation: Exploring Precision and Significant Figures
While 46.26 kg is a perfectly acceptable conversion for most purposes, let's briefly touch upon precision. The number of significant figures you use will depend on the context. If you’re dealing with a rough estimate, rounding to 46 kg might suffice. However, for more precise applications, you should maintain the accuracy afforded by the conversion factor. Understanding significant figures ensures you don't over- or under-represent the accuracy of your measurement.
